【文档向】手把手教你的队友用git+LaTex管理板子

故事会

shk001:我们建个TX文档管理我们队的板子⑧!

tudouuuuu:兹磁!

教练:今天我们查板子,大家要打印下来噢!

shk001:这TX文档坑我!东西下下来代码块没用的!

江老板:为啥管理队伍板子不用git呢?

 

队长前置操作

1)我们假设你的英语洋屁水平过关,找到一个合适的地方选择new repository,进入后可以这样填:

2)如果是private库的话请看这一步,是public库请直接进行下一步

因为题目是手把手教你的队友,假设我们的队长已经熟♂练地在github交友了。

大家共同努力建设良好库

1)此时作为队友在网址中粘贴后enter,接受邀请就好qwq。

好了,现在你加入了全球最大同性交流网站。

2)在电脑上安装Git

这里建议康康廖雪峰的教程:https://www.liaoxuefeng.com/wiki/896043488029600/896067074338496

如果在这一步有报错,建议复制错误然后百度。

3)SSH Key的配置

这一步我也建议按照廖雪峰的教程:https://www.liaoxuefeng.com/wiki/896043488029600/896954117292416

同理,报错直接复制百度。

4)如果是受剥削队员请看这一步并尝试自己理解pull request,如果是受宠队员请直接看下一步。

叉走(folk)队长事先new好的库

这个时候在你的Repositories中会发现你也有这样的库了。

5)将整个远程库clone下来

利用cd等命令打开一个合适的文件夹,输入类似于这样的命令

 1 $ git clone https://github.com/fudouame/zjut14template_ex.git 

注意将https://github.com/fudouame/zjut14template_ex.git这部分替换成你的。

运气足够好,会返回:

1 Cloning into 'zjut14template_ex'...
2 remote: Enumerating objects: 5, done.
3 remote: Counting objects: 100% (5/5), done.
4 remote: Compressing objects: 100% (5/5), done.
5 remote: Total 5 (delta 0), reused 0 (delta 0), pack-reused 0
6 Unpacking objects: 100% (5/5), done.

然后打开你的文件夹,里面就会和远程仓库一样啦!

6)本地项目关联服务器项目

在git bash一通cd后,进入到相应的文件夹,输入:

1 git remote add origin https://github.com/TuDouuuuu/zjut14template_ex

此时就将本地项目和服务器项目关联起来了qwq。

如果提示了fatal: remote origin already exists,那么输入:

1 git remote rm origin

7)在本地放入你想要的东西

希望你是一个勤快的人,嗯,希望……

8)提交本地修改到github服务器

1 git pull origin master //pull代码到本地
2 git add . //添加了所有新增的文件
3 git commit -m "这个时候随便commit什么就好只要你不被队友打"
4 git push -u origin master  //push代码到服务器

9)去相应的github界面看看有没有多了什么

 

 

先写一段故事会和一小部分git,剩下的慢慢写……

posted @ 2019-09-21 23:36  tudouuuuu  阅读(458)  评论(0编辑  收藏  举报